M
Motivators
35 employees
Motivators is an advertising and e-commerce platform.
Basic info
Industry
other
Sectors
E-Commerce Platforms
E-Commerce
Advertising
Advertising Platforms
Date founded
1979
FAQ
How to get an intro to Motivators?